Blockchain Beyond Bitcoin: Real-World Use Cases

While Bitcoin is the most recognized application of blockchain technology, its potential extends far beyond cryptocurrency. Various industries are leveraging blockchain for its security, transparency, and efficiency. Here’s a look at some compelling real-world use cases of blockchain technology.

1. Supply Chain Management

Overview

Blockchain enhances transparency and traceability in supply chains, allowing all parties to track products from origin to consumer.

Benefits

  • Improved Traceability: Each transaction is recorded on an immutable ledger, making it easier to trace the journey of products.
  • Reduced Fraud: Ensures authenticity by verifying the origin of goods, which is crucial in sectors like pharmaceuticals and food.

2. Healthcare

Overview

Blockchain can securely store and share patient records, ensuring privacy and improving the efficiency of healthcare delivery.

Benefits

  • Data Security: Patient data is encrypted and accessible only to authorized personnel, protecting sensitive information.
  • Interoperability: Different healthcare providers can access and share patient information seamlessly, enhancing coordinated care.

3. Voting Systems

Overview

Blockchain technology can create secure and transparent voting systems, potentially increasing voter trust and participation.

Benefits

  • Transparency: Each vote is recorded on a public ledger, making the election process verifiable and reducing the risk of tampering.
  • Accessibility: Remote voting through blockchain can increase participation, especially for those unable to vote in person.

4. Real Estate

Overview

Blockchain can streamline property transactions by providing a secure and transparent platform for buying, selling, and leasing real estate.

Benefits

  • Smart Contracts: Automates transactions and reduces the need for intermediaries, simplifying processes like title transfers.
  • Reduced Costs: Lowers transaction costs by eliminating middlemen and reducing paperwork.

5. Financial Services

Overview

Blockchain is transforming the financial industry by enabling faster and cheaper transactions, as well as improving security.

Benefits

  • Cross-Border Payments: Facilitates instant, low-cost international transactions, making remittances more affordable.
  • Decentralized Finance (DeFi): Offers financial services without traditional banks, allowing users to lend, borrow, and trade directly.

6. Identity Verification

Overview

Blockchain can provide secure digital identities, reducing fraud and simplifying the verification process across various sectors.

Benefits

  • Control Over Personal Data: Individuals can manage their own identity data, granting access only to authorized parties.
  • Streamlined Verification: Businesses can verify identities quickly and securely, reducing onboarding times and costs.

7. Intellectual Property

Overview

Blockchain can protect intellectual property rights by providing a secure and transparent way to register and track creative works.

Benefits

  • Proof of Ownership: Creators can register their work on the blockchain, establishing a clear record of ownership.
  • Royalty Distribution: Smart contracts can automate royalty payments, ensuring creators receive fair compensation for their work.
